5.3 Timer / Keyboard / Zoom
By correct reception of a RS232 protocol (configuration via
PC Setup
) all defined data
fields are displayed and the following Timer start:
§
Relay:
Defines the time the relay is in
energized state (assignment page 5).
The relay is triggerd by text insertion of
the protocol data and inactivated after
the defined time. The maximum time is
99 seconds.
By setting ‘00sec’ the relay is not
triggerd by protocol data.
§
Data:
Defines the time the text insertion
of protocol data is active (range from 1
to 99 seconds).
NOTE:
If the relay timer and data timer after a data reception are active, and the unit receives
new protocol data, the timer start anew. In this case the relay- respectively data -
insertion is longer active as defined .
§
Keyboard:
Defines the keyboard layout (english / german) of the connected PS/2
keyboard.
§
Zoom factor:
Definition of the character size ‘x 01’ (11 rows consisting of 28
characters) respectively ‘x 02’ (6 rows consisting of 16 characters).
NOTE:
By zoom-setting ‘x 02’ the user should check the right positioning of time / date
within the 6x16 raster.
